MUR Hedge Fund Activity: Q2 2025 in Review

370 of the 7,595 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Murphy Oil (MUR) for Q2 2025, worth a combined $3.05B — down 18% from $3.72B a quarter earlier.

Sellers outnumbered buyers: 56 funds closed out of MUR and 46 opened new positions — a net loss of 10 holders — while 115 trimmed existing stakes and 159 added.

The largest buyer was UBS Group, adding an estimated $68.3M. The largest seller was BlackRock, cutting an estimated $32.9M.
